List of attacks on civilians attributed to Sri Lankan government forces
The following is a list of attacks on civilians attributed to armed groups under the control of the Sri Lankan government - Army, Navy, Air Force, Police and paramilitary groups (Home Guards/Civil Defence Force, EPDP, PLOTE, TMVP etc.). This list does not contain assassinations which are listed in a separate article.
The Sri Lankan Armed Forces which is almost exclusively made up of Sinhalese ethnicity has engaged in several counts of violence against Tamils including numerous instances of civilian massacres, ethnic cleansing, pogroms, forced disappearances, sexual violence, destruction of property and assassination of Tamil civil leaders. 〔(【引用サイトリンク】 title=Genocide Against Tamil People: Massacres, Pogroms, Destruction of Property, Sexual Violence and Assassinations of Civil Society Leaders )
